Emerging Trends and Innovation Drivers in Japan Solar Panel Cleaning Service Market

The industry is witnessing a surge in automation, with robotic cleaning systems gaining prominence for their efficiency and safety benefits. AI-powered sensors enable predictive maintenance, reducing downtime and operational costs. Waterless cleaning technologies, including electrostatic and dry cleaning methods, are gaining traction, aligning with Japan’s environmental standards.

Furthermore, the integration of IoT platforms facilitates real-time monitoring and remote management, enhancing service quality and customer satisfaction. The adoption of eco-friendly cleaning agents and biodegradable solutions reflects a strategic shift towards sustainability. Floating solar projects and urban solar initiatives are opening new avenues for specialized cleaning services, demanding tailored solutions.

Investment in R&D by technology firms and service providers is accelerating innovation, with startups exploring autonomous drones and advanced water recycling systems. These trends collectively position Japan’s solar panel cleaning industry at the forefront of sustainable, high-tech energy infrastructure maintenance.
